Unfortunately, we received a cease-and-desist notice from Garage Software, inc. for using sound assets from their 'Band' software without their permission. Thus, in this update, we have hastily replaced all the musical instruments in the game's soundtrack with versions that the developer and some of his friends hastily recorded at 4 am.

We apologize for this sudden change, and will be working to further refine the music and sounds of Tanks in the coming weeks. For more information about this change, please check out our blog post here: https://tanks-thecrusades.com/tanks-sounds-updates

Update: this was an April Fools joke, and the sounds are back to normal. But if you liked the sounds, you can still use them! Download the sound pack here and extract the contents to the ~/.tanks/resources folder, such that the "music" and "sound" folders are in there. If the resources folder doesn't exist, make it yourself!
